Salary Range: $5,994 to $6,717 (per 4 credit undergraduate course, 3 credit graduate course). Rate of pay is determined by academic credential and years of teaching experience.
Job Summary:
The University of St. Thomas Department of Modern and Classical Languages invites applications for adjunct faculty to teach Elementary Spanish II courses for undergraduate students for the Fall 2025 semester, with the possibility of additional course assignment(s) in the spring depending on the department’s needs. The successful candidate(s) will teach in person on Monday, Wednesday and Friday from 10:55 a.m. -12:00 p.m. and 12:15-1:20 p.m.
